Polyoxyethylene Sorbitan Monolaurate (432) is a emulsifier additive holding a composite safety score of 3 out of 5 (Mixed Evidence). According to the U.S. Food and Drug Administration's Substances Added to Food inventory, it is currently classified as Approved, while the European Union lists it as Approved. It is most commonly used as Sauces, dressings, baked goods, ice cream.

No U.S. state has enacted specific legislation targeting Polyoxyethylene Sorbitan Monolaurate to date, keeping federal FDA classification as the operative standard. State-level food safety legislation remains active nationally, and that picture may shift as new bills advance.

Peer-reviewed research has flagged 1 distinct area of health concern for Polyoxyethylene Sorbitan Monolaurate, which factors directly into the assigned safety score. The European Food Safety Authority has published an evaluation dated 2015-07-17, with an Acceptable Daily Intake (ADI) of 25. EFSA has noted an overexposure risk classification of "moderate" for typical consumption patterns.
